Get to know xPM

xPM is a specialized business line within Context& focused on Strategy, Project, Portfolio, and Resource Management. With 20+ years of experience, we combine deep domain expertise with Microsoft technologies like AI and Copilot to help organizations plan, prioritize, and manage resources effectively. 

One of our key offerings is Projectum xPM, a platform of tools that adapts to an organization’s portfolio management needs. It aligns strategy, structure, and work types to simplify complex processes and drive successful execution. We go beyond software, delivering intuitive tools that fill market gaps and enhance decision-making.

About Context& 

Context& was created through the merger of Consit, Delegate, and Projectum - three of the Nordic region’s leading Microsoft partners. We are built on three principles: 

  • People: We succeed because we work in strong teams, share knowledge, and collaborate closely with our clients. 

  • Innovation: We use AI and Microsoft technology to create solutions that deliver real business and societal impact. 

  • Trust: We deliver on our promises and place quality and integrity at the center of how we work. 

As part of The Digital Neighborhood; a network of 9 specialized European IT companies, we can also draw on expertise and resources across countries and technologies when the task requires it.
